Introduction
The Building Automation Systems Market is experiencing substantial growth as industries increasingly adopt smart technologies to improve energy efficiency, operational control, and sustainability. Building automation systems (BAS) integrate hardware and software to monitor and manage building functions such as HVAC, lighting, security, and energy usage. With the growing emphasis on smart infrastructure, the market is expected to expand significantly over the forecast period.
Market Size and Growth Outlook
The global Building Automation Systems Market was valued at USD 87.85 billion in 2025 and is projected to grow from USD 94.5 billion in 2026 to USD 184.42 billion by 2034, registering a CAGR of 8.70% during the forecast period.
This growth is driven by increasing demand for energy-efficient solutions, rapid urbanization, and the adoption of IoT-enabled systems across various sectors.

Key Market Drivers
Rising Demand for Energy Efficiency
Energy efficiency has become a critical priority for governments and organizations worldwide. Building automation systems help reduce energy consumption, minimize operational costs, and support sustainability initiatives.
Growth in Smart Buildings
The increasing adoption of smart buildings is a major factor driving market growth. BAS enables real-time monitoring, automation, and remote control, enhancing comfort, safety, and operational efficiency.
Rapid Urbanization and Infrastructure Development
Emerging economies are witnessing rapid urbanization and infrastructure expansion. This trend is fueling the demand for advanced building management solutions in both commercial and residential sectors.
Integration of Advanced Technologies
Technologies such as Internet of Things (IoT), artificial intelligence (AI), cloud computing, and building information modeling (BIM) are transforming the building automation landscape. These technologies enhance system efficiency and enable predictive maintenance.
Market Trends
IoT-Enabled Automation
IoT integration allows seamless communication between devices, enabling real-time data collection, monitoring, and automation. This trend is significantly improving building performance.
Cloud-Based Solutions
Cloud-based building automation systems are gaining popularity due to their scalability, flexibility, and remote accessibility.
Focus on Sustainable and Green Buildings
The rising focus on reducing carbon emissions and promoting green buildings is accelerating the adoption of energy-efficient automation systems.
Market Segmentation
By Product Type
Hardware: Includes sensors, controllers, and user interfaces, dominating the market due to high demand.
Software: Expected to grow rapidly with increasing adoption of cloud-based platforms.
By Application
HVAC systems hold the largest share due to their significant role in energy management.
Safety and security systems and energy management solutions are also witnessing strong growth.
By End User
Commercial sector dominates the market, driven by demand from offices, hospitals, retail outlets, and hotels.
Residential and industrial sectors are also expanding steadily.
Regional Insights
North America
North America holds the largest market share due to strict energy regulations and widespread adoption of smart building technologies.
Europe
Europe is witnessing strong growth due to sustainability initiatives and energy efficiency standards.
Asia Pacific
Asia Pacific is expected to grow at the fastest rate due to rapid urbanization, increasing construction activities, and rising adoption of smart technologies in countries such as China, India, and Japan.

Market Challenges
Cybersecurity Concerns
As building automation systems become more interconnected, they are more vulnerable to cyber threats, which may impact system reliability and security.
Limited Awareness
Lack of awareness, especially in developing regions, may hinder the adoption of building automation systems.
